San Francisco-based studio FUTUREFORMS explores the concept of digital craft through computational design, transforming algorithms into immersive public art installations. Projects such as Orbital in San Francisco and Weatherscape in El Paso demonstrate how digital fabrication, environmental forces and interactive design can redefine contemporary public space.

Installed at the highest point of Lauritzen Gardens’ renewed Children’s Garden, Chorus Ventus by NEON is a kinetic sculpture inspired by the tallgrass prairie of North America. Composed of 151 curved steel tubes and flexible rods tipped with coloured bells, the installation responds to wind and human interaction to create a subtle choreography of movement and sound. The artwork merges ecological storytelling, durable engineering and landscape design to form a playful landmark visible from afar while offering visitors a contemplative viewpoint above the gardens.

Ekadea Studio in Milan reimagines the ceramic workshop as an immersive architectural environment shaped by curved walls, filtered light and ritual thresholds. The design integrates elements such as okumè plywood worktables, shōji screens and tatami platforms to create a layered spatial experience where craft, material and shadow interact. Through subtle transitions and controlled illumination, the studio offers a quiet refuge from the city while celebrating the gestures of artisanal practice.
